FAQs About Padres Spring Training Record
What constitutes a successful spring training for the Padres?
A successful spring training can be characterized by improved player performances, successful integration of new players, and healthy competition among team members. A strong winloss record is a bonus, but not the ultimate goal.
How does spring training performance impact the regular season expectations?
Teams often view spring training as a launch pad; a winning record can instill confidence, while a poor performance may push teams to reevaluate strategies and refine skills before entering the season.
Who are the standout players for the Padres during spring training?
Players like Fernando Tatis Jr. typically shine during spring training, but other emerging talents can also make headlines. Keeping track of individual stats helps fans and analysts identify potential breakout stars.
What tools do coaches use during spring training for player evaluation?
Coaches often rely on various analytics tools, along with traditional scouting methods, to assess player performance, including game film, statistics, and player efficiency metrics.
Is there significance to a team’s spring training location?
Yes, the environment can impact player performance. Some teams choose Arizona or Florida based on climate advantages that facilitate effective training sessions.
Do injuries impact a team’s spring training strategy?
Absolutely, injuries can drastically influence a team’s dynamics. The coaching staff must adjust both training protocols and game strategies in response to these challenges, emphasizing resilience and adaptability.
